## **[Unreleased]**
|
||||
- [#542](https://github.com/wasmerio/wasmer/pull/542) Add SIMD support to wasmer and implement it in the LLVM backend only.
|
||||
- [#555](https://github.com/wasmerio/wasmer/pull/555) WASI filesystem rewrite. Major improvements
|
||||
- adds virtual root showing all preopened directories
|
||||
- improved sandboxing and code-reuse
|
||||
- symlinks work in a lot more situations
|
||||
- many various improvements to most syscalls touching the filesystem
|
||||
|
||||
## 0.5.6
|
||||
- [#565](https://github.com/wasmerio/wasmer/pull/565) Update wapm and bump version to 0.5.6
